Development of intelligent services in telecommunications networks using IoT

This article examines how to develop intelligent services in telecommunications networks using IoT. IoT plays a crucial role in telecommunications networks as it enables the connection of multiple devices to the internet and facilitates data exchange between them. For fast and stable information transfer between IoT devices, telecommunications infrastructure is of key importance. IoT can be applied not only in telecommunications networks but also in other fields. IoT systems, utilizing various technologies, demonstrate how telecommunications infrastructure can be developed. In my article, I will discuss specific areas where IoT is applied, various IoT applications, and how they contribute to intelligent development. The article explores the development of intelligent services in telecommunications networks using IoT technologies. The study proposes the BRT (Balanced Resource Transmission) algorithm based on Edge Computing, which optimizes the operation of IoT systems. Additionally, the MAS-LSTM method (Multi-Agent System + Long Short-Term Memory neural network) is used to improve anomaly detection accuracy. These data are applied for monitoring production processes. The use of IoT contributes to the intelligent development of telecommunications networks.
